Output bd579ccbad7b590f6f81352843dcfc206e54459ba714656d5b8a5bcd3489b59d:0

value
26516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d87521c88eb55d5525b6fd94f6899ee0e20897 OP_EQUAL
address
3MNJWXBvj7Dat6qycgPEJPeGHV5GFwvZwk
transaction
bd579ccbad7b590f6f81352843dcfc206e54459ba714656d5b8a5bcd3489b59d
confirmations
344884
spent
false

1 Sat Range